What are the current mortgage rates like in Evensville, TN, and how do they compare to the national average?
Mortgage rates in Evensville typically align closely with Tennessee state averages, which are often slightly below the national average due to the state's lower cost of living. However, rates can vary between lenders in the Rhea County area, so it's wise to shop around with local credit unions, regional banks, and national lenders. Factors like your credit score and loan type will have a more significant impact on your specific rate than the city itself.
Are there any down payment assistance programs specifically for homebuyers in Evensville or Rhea County?
Yes, the Tennessee Housing Development Agency (THDA) offers the Great Choice Home Loan program, which is available statewide, including in Evensville. This program provides competitive interest rates and down payment assistance for eligible first-time and repeat homebuyers. Additionally, it's worth checking with local lenders about any community-specific grants or programs that may occasionally be offered in the area.
How does the appraisal process work in Evensville's rural and small-town market?
Given Evensville's rural setting within Rhea County, appraisals can be more challenging due to fewer comparable home sales ("comps"). Appraisers often need to look at a wider geographic area or older sales data, which can sometimes impact the appraised value. Working with a local lender who understands the nuances of the Dayton/Evensville market is crucial to ensure a smooth appraisal process.
What type of property inspections are especially important when getting a mortgage for an older home in Evensville?
For Evensville's many charming older homes, a thorough general inspection is essential, but specific inspections for septic systems and well water are highly recommended. Many properties in the area are not on city sewer and water. Lenders will require these systems to be functional, and any issues discovered could become a condition for loan approval.
As a first-time homebuyer in Evensville, what should I know about property taxes and insurance?
Rhea County property taxes are generally considered low compared to national and even state averages, which is a benefit for homeowners. For insurance, it's important to note that some areas outside the city limits may be considered higher risk for wildfire or may require additional flood insurance considerations, especially near creeks or the Tennessee River. Your lender will help you factor these escrow costs accurately into your monthly payment.
